A:LINK {text-decoration:none; font-weight:normal; color:#ea5e29; outline: none;} 
A:VISITED {text-decoration:none; font-weight:normal; color:#ea5e29; outline: none;} 
A:ACTIVE {text-decoration:none; font-weight:normal; color:#ea5e29; outline: none;}
A:HOVER {text-decoration:underline; font-weight:normal; color:#666666; outline: none;}
.aLink:LINK {text-decoration:none; color:#8C0000; outline: none;} 
.aLink:VISITED {text-decoration:none; color:#8C0000; outline: none;} 
.aLink:ACTIVE {text-decoration:none; color:#8C0000; outline: none;}
.aLink:HOVER {text-decoration:underline; color:#666666; outline: none;}
h1 { font-family : Arial, Helvetica, sans-serif; font-size : 12px; font-weight : bold; line-height : 25px; color : #666666; letter-spacing: 2px;}
h2 { font-family : Arial, Helvetica, sans-serif; font-size : 11px; font-weight : bold; line-height : 15px; color : #666666; letter-spacing: 1.8px;}
h3 { font-family : Arial, Helvetica, sans-serif; font-size : 10px; font-weight : bold; line-height : 10px; color : #666666; letter-spacing: 1.5px;}
h4 { font-family : Arial, Helvetica, sans-serif; font-size : 12px; font-weight : bold; line-height : 25px; color : #000000; letter-spacing: 2px;}
h5 { font-family : Arial, Helvetica, sans-serif; font-size : 11px; font-weight : bold; line-height : 15px; color : #000000; letter-spacing: 1.8px;}
h6 { font-family : Arial, Helvetica, sans-serif; font-size : 10px; font-weight : bold; line-height : 10px; color : #000000; letter-spacing: 1.5px;}
 p {font-family:Verdana, Helvetica, Arial; font-size:8pt; color:#666666;}
 tr {font-family:Verdana, Helvetica, Arial; font-size:8pt; color:#666666;}
 td {font-family:Verdana, Helvetica, Arial; font-size:8pt; color:#666666;}
.pkleiner {font-family:Verdana, Arial, Helvetica, sans-serif; font-size:7pt; color:#666666; letter-spacing:0.1mm;}
.pcopyright {font-family:Verdana, Arial, Helvetica, sans-serif; font-size:7pt; color:#ea5e29; letter-spacing:0.1mm;}
.hgross {font-family:Arial, Helvetica, sans-serif; font-size:16px; color: #ea5e29; font-weight: bold; letter-spacing:0.4mm;}
.hmittel {font-family:Arial, Helvetica, sans-serif; font-size:13px; color: #ea5e29; font-weight: bold; letter-spacing:0.3mm; line-height:1.2em;}
.hklein {font-family:Arial, Helvetica, sans-serif; font-size:14px; color: #ea5e29; font-weight: normal; letter-spacing:0.1mm;}
.black {font-family:Arial, Helvetica, sans-serif; font-size:13px; color: #666666; font-weight: bold; letter-spacing:0.3mm; line-height:1.2em;}
.seminare { font-family : Arial, Helvetica, sans-serif; font-size:14px; color : #FFFFFF; font-weight: bold; background-color:#ea5e29}
.hgrau {font-family:Arial, Helvetica, sans-serif; font-size:14px; color: #666666; font-weight: normal; letter-spacing:0.1mm;}
.bold {font-family:Arial, Helvetica, sans-serif; font-size:8pt; color: #ea5e29; font-weight: bold;}

.zitat {font-family: 'Courgette', cursive; font-size:24px; color: #ea5e29; }

#navcontainer
{
position:absolute;
right:0px;
top:350px;
z-index:15;
width: 225px;
}

#navcontainer ul
{
margin-left: 0;
padding-left: 0px;
list-style-type: none;
font-family: Verdana, Helvetica, Arial; font-size:0.7em; line-height:1.2em;
}

#navcontainer a
{
display: block;
padding: 0.5em;
color:#666666;
border-bottom: 1px solid #ea5e29;
}

#navcontainer a:link, #navlist a:visited
{
color: #666666;
text-decoration: none;
}

#navcontainer a:hover
{
background-color: #fff8ee;
color: #ea5e29;
}

#active a:link, #active a:visited, #active a:hover
{
background-color: #FFFFFF;
color: #ea5e29;
}

#green a:link, #green a:visited
{
background-color: #eee;
border-left: 5px solid #6aa512;
color: #6aa512;
}

#green a:hover
{
background-color: #6aa512;
color: #fff;
}

#blue a:link, #blue a:visited
{
background-color: #eee;
border-left: 5px solid #3e99ff;
color: #3e99ff;
}

#blue a:hover
{
background-color: #3e99ff;
color: #fff;
}

.line {border-bottom: 1px solid #ea5e29;}

BODY {text-align: center; background-color:#FFFFFF; background-image:url(../images/bg_body.gif); background-repeat:repeat-x;}
INPUT, TEXTAREA {BORDER-COLOR: #E3E3E3; FONT-FAMILY: Arial, Helvetica; FONT-SIZE: 10px;background-color:#fff8ee; border: 1px solid #ea5e29;}